// // Button groups // -------------------------------------------------- // Make the div behave like a button .btn-group, .btn-group-vertical { position: relative; display: inline-block; vertical-align: middle; // match .btn alignment given font-size hack above > .btn { position: relative; float: left; // Bring the "active" button to the front &:hover, &:focus, &:active, &.active { z-index: 2; } &:focus { // Remove focus outline when dropdown JS adds it after closing the menu outline: 0; } } } // Prevent double borders when buttons are next to each other .btn-group { .btn + .btn, .btn + .btn-group, .btn-group + .btn, .btn-group + .btn-group { margin-left: -1px; } } // Optional: Group multiple button groups together for a toolbar .btn-toolbar { margin-left: -5px; // Offset the first child's margin &:extend(.clearfix all); .btn-group, .input-group { float: left; } > .btn, > .btn-group, > .input-group { margin-left: 5px; } } .btn-group > .btn:not(:first-child):not(:last-child):not(.dropdown-toggle) { border-radius: 0; } // Set corners individual because sometimes a single button can be in a .btn-group and we need :first-child and :last-child to both match .btn-group > .btn:first-child { margin-left: 0; &:not(:last-child):not(.dropdown-toggle) { .border-right-radius(0); } } // Need .dropdown-toggle since :last-child doesn't apply given a .dropdown-menu immediately after it .btn-group > .btn:last-child:not(:first-child), .btn-group > .dropdown-toggle:not(:first-child) { .border-left-radius(0); } // Custom edits for including btn-groups within btn-groups (useful for including dropdown buttons within a btn-group) .btn-group > .btn-group { float: left; } .btn-group > .btn-group:not(:first-child):not(:last-child) > .btn { border-radius: 0; } .btn-group > .btn-group:first-child { > .btn:last-child, > .dropdown-toggle { .border-right-radius(0); } } .btn-group > .btn-group:last-child > .btn:first-child { .border-left-radius(0); } // On active and open, don't show outline .btn-group .dropdown-toggle:active, .btn-group.open .dropdown-toggle { outline: 0; } // Sizing // // Remix the default button sizing classes into new ones for easier manipulation. .btn-group-xs > .btn { &:extend(.btn-xs); } .btn-group-sm > .btn { &:extend(.btn-sm); } .btn-group-lg > .btn { &:extend(.btn-lg); } // Split button dropdowns // ---------------------- // Give the line between buttons some depth .btn-group > .btn + .dropdown-toggle { padding-left: 8px; padding-right: 8px; } .btn-group > .btn-lg + .dropdown-toggle { padding-left: 12px; padding-right: 12px; } // The clickable button for toggling the menu // Remove the gradient and set the same inset shadow as the :active state .btn-group.open .dropdown-toggle { .box-shadow(inset 0 3px 5px rgba(0,0,0,.125)); // Show no shadow for `.btn-link` since it has no other button styles. &.btn-link { .box-shadow(none); } } // Reposition the caret .btn .caret { margin-left: 0; } // Carets in other button sizes .btn-lg .caret { border-width: @caret-width-large @caret-width-large 0; border-bottom-width: 0; } // Upside down carets for .dropup .dropup .btn-lg .caret { border-width: 0 @caret-width-large @caret-width-large; } // Vertical button groups // ---------------------- .btn-group-vertical { > .btn, > .btn-group, > .btn-group > .btn { display: block; float: none; width: 100%; max-width: 100%; } // Clear floats so dropdown menus can be properly placed > .btn-group { &:extend(.clearfix all); > .btn { float: none; } } > .btn + .btn, > .btn + .btn-group, > .btn-group + .btn, > .btn-group + .btn-group { margin-top: -1px; margin-left: 0; } } .btn-group-vertical > .btn { &:not(:first-child):not(:last-child) { border-radius: 0; } &:first-child:not(:last-child) { border-top-right-radius: @border-radius-base; .border-bottom-radius(0); } &:last-child:not(:first-child) { border-bottom-left-radius: @border-radius-base; .border-top-radius(0); } } .btn-group-vertical > .btn-group:not(:first-child):not(:last-child) > .btn { border-radius: 0; } .btn-group-vertical > .btn-group:first-child:not(:last-child) { > .btn:last-child, > .dropdown-toggle { .border-bottom-radius(0); } } .btn-group-vertical > .btn-group:last-child:not(:first-child) > .btn:first-child { .border-top-radius(0); } // Justified button groups // ---------------------- .btn-group-justified { display: table; width: 100%; table-layout: fixed; border-collapse: separate; > .btn, > .btn-group { float: none; display: table-cell; width: 1%; } > .btn-group .btn { width: 100%; } > .btn-group .dropdown-menu { left: auto; } } // Checkbox and radio options // // In order to support the browser's form validation feedback, powered by the // `required` attribute, we have to "hide" the inputs via `opacity`. We cannot // use `display: none;` or `visibility: hidden;` as that also hides the popover. // This way, we ensure a DOM element is visible to position the popover from. // // See https://github.com/twbs/bootstrap/pull/12794 for more. [data-toggle="buttons"] > .btn > input[type="radio"], [data-toggle="buttons"] > .btn > input[type="checkbox"] { position: absolute; z-index: -1; .opacity(0); } .elementor-animation-grow-rotate { transition-duration: 0.3s; transition-property: transform; } .elementor-animation-grow-rotate:active, .elementor-animation-grow-rotate:focus, .elementor-animation-grow-rotate:hover { transform: scale(1.1) rotate(4deg); } {"id":62386,"date":"2025-09-25T13:27:18","date_gmt":"2025-09-25T11:27:18","guid":{"rendered":"https:\/\/www.solucionessmart.com.uy\/smartporteria\/?p=62386"},"modified":"2026-03-20T16:09:16","modified_gmt":"2026-03-20T15:09:16","slug":"h1-onvaya-intelligente-losungen-hair-ein-22","status":"publish","type":"post","link":"https:\/\/www.solucionessmart.com.uy\/smartporteria\/2025\/09\/25\/h1-onvaya-intelligente-losungen-hair-ein-22\/","title":{"rendered":"
Im Berufsleben z\u00e4hlt der erste Eindruck– und dazu geh\u00f6rt auch eine gut organisierte Unterlagenf\u00fchrung. Eine hochwertige Konferenzmappe bewahrt Dokumente, Visitenkarten und Schreibutensilien sicher auf und sorgt f\u00fcr einen souver\u00e4nen Auftritt. Sie ist der ideale Begleiter f\u00fcr Meetings, Pr\u00e4sentationen und Gesch\u00e4ftsreisen. Mit der durchdachten Schreibmappe von ONVAYA Produkte<\/a> hinterlassen Sie bei Gesch\u00e4ftspartnern garantiert einen professionellen Eindruck.<\/p>\n Besuch steht vor der T\u00fcr, und schnell stellt sich die Frage nach bequemen Hausschuhen. Ein praktisches Establish mit mehreren Paaren in verschiedenen Gr\u00f6\u00dfen l\u00f6st dieses Problem stilvoll und hygienisch. Pass away rutschfeste Sohle sorgt f\u00fcr sicheren Tritt auf allen B\u00f6den, w\u00e4hrend weiches Product h\u00f6chsten Tragekomfort bietet. Die durchdachten G\u00e4stehausschuhe von ONVAYA Produkte<\/a> machen jeden Besuch zu einem rundum angenehmen Erlebnis.<\/p>\n Hair Allergiker kann pass away Belastung durch Hausstaubmilben im Schlafzimmer besonders belastend sein. Moderne Ultraschallger\u00e4te bieten eine chemiefreie M\u00f6glichkeit, pass away Milbenpopulation zu reduzieren und so f\u00fcr ein hygienischeres Umfeld zu sorgen. Einfach in die Steckdose gesteckt, arbeiten sie leise im Hintergrund und verbessern nachhaltig das Raumklima. Der cutting-edge Milbencontroller von ONVAYA Produkte<\/a> hilft Ihnen dabei, beschwerdefreier zu schlafen und durchzuatmen.<\/p>\n Ob M\u00fclltrennung, Gew\u00fcrzaufbewahrung oder pass away Lagerung von Lebensmitteln– ein intestine organisierter Haushalt spart Zeit und Nerven. Robuste M\u00fcllsackst\u00e4nder erleichtern das Entsorgen, w\u00e4hrend luftdichte Vorratsbeh\u00e4lter Lebensmittel l\u00e4nger frisch halten. Auch die Trennung von Wertstoffen wird mit durchdachten Systemen zum Kinderspiel. Pass away praktischen K\u00fcchenhelfer von ONVAYA Produkte<\/a> bringen Struktur in den oft chaotischen Alltag.<\/p>\nKomfort hair G\u00e4ste und Familie<\/h2>\n
Gesundes Raumklima durch ingenious Technik<\/h2>\n
Clevere Helfer hair K\u00fcche und Haushalt<\/h2>\n
Ordnung in jedem Raum mit Stil<\/h2>\n